Output aaf599d3efd70565a8f21c7652b3e12f82e7e28719b7f60df4b19f1699b9585b:0

value
21057199
script pubkey
OP_0 OP_PUSHBYTES_20 21f657871856b0ed43d616959b8d6cf1a4090296
address
bc1qy8m90pcc26cw6s7kz62ehrtv7xjqjq5ky78v8k
transaction
aaf599d3efd70565a8f21c7652b3e12f82e7e28719b7f60df4b19f1699b9585b
confirmations
436158
spent
true